Full Job Description

Location: Chicago, IL, United States

Join a team that helps deliver consistent, high-quality execution across lending deal setup. You will help prevent defects, improve turnaround times, and strengthen controls through detailed review and partnership.

Job summary

As a Quality Control Specialist in Deal Setup Quality Control, you perform daily quality control reviews across deal setup activities to ensure accuracy, timeliness, and adherence to documented procedures and controls. You partner with internal stakeholders to resolve exceptions, reduce rework, and support consistent execution against service level commitments.

Job responsibilities 

  • Perform quality control review and validation for deal setup activities, ensuring completeness and accuracy prior to completion
  • Meet established quality and volume service level commitments, including same-day completion requirements where applicable
  • Follow documented controls, policies, and procedures; escalate issues when requirements are not met
  • Validate client documentation and reconcile data across credit and loan systems to prevent defects and rework
  • Follow up with external agents/customers and internal partners for missing notifications, documentation, or confirmations to enable timely closure
  • Partner with Business, Legal, and Operations stakeholders to clarify requirements, resolve exceptions, and reduce turnaround time
  • Maintain accurate records of work performed, provide clear status updates, and support effective handoffs
  • Identify recurring errors, share insights, and contribute improvement ideas to enhance quality, efficiency, and stakeholder experience
  •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ills

  • Bachelors degree in Finance or a related field, or equivalent work experience
  • Experience in financial services with consistent delivery in a controlled operations environment
  • Understanding of business financial statements and lending/loan concepts across industries
  • Strong attention to detail and quality mindset, with ability to identify defects, inconsistencies, and missing requirements
  • Strong research, analytical, and comprehension skills, including ability to interpret and validate information across multiple sources and systems
  • Effective time management and prioritization skills to meet deadlines, manage multiple assignments, and sustain quality standards
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ills, including ability to escalate clearly and in a timely manner
  •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ills

  • Experience supporting lending deal setup workflows and performing quality control reviews
  • Working knowledge of loan systems and tools (for example, ACBS, LIQ, and/or VLS)
  • Experience supporting control reporting, issue tracking, and root-cause identification
  • Demonstrated ability to partner across teams and adapt to changing priorities while maintaining accuracy
  • Ensure accurate, timely quality review of lending deal setup work to reduce defects and support strong client outcomes.
